Job Summary
Assists in the execution of research objectives, data collection, and data management. Performs routine procedures, statistical analysis, scientific analysis, and reporting. Integrates data and data sets, performs descriptive and exploratory analysis, and creates routine reports and analysis reporting tools. Utilizes statistical software and adheres to all protocols.
Essential Functions
Data Analysis & Performance Monitoring
Design and maintain data visualizations and dashboards that inform QAPI and quality performance improvement activities
Track and trend key transplant program performance metrics across clinical, operational, and outcomes domains
Conduct analyses of transplant clinical outcomes across multiple organ programs, including benchmarking against national standards such as SRTR risk-adjusted models
Data Integrity & Regulatory Compliance
Assist in the preparation, validation, and reconciliation of data submissions internal and external to the program
Identify and resolve discrepancies between internal EMR records and registry submissions
Apply knowledge of federal regulations and transplant-specific policy to ensure alignment with CMS and OPTN data requirements
Implement data management best practices to ensure accuracy, consistency, and integrity across registry submissions and internal reporting
Support data readiness activities for CMS and OPTN program surveys
Reporting & Strategic Support
Respond to routine and ad hoc data requests from transplant physicians, program directors, and hospital leadership, communicating findings clearly to clinical and non-technical stakeholders
Translate complex clinical and operational data into clear analyses and presentations for program and hospital leadership
Deliver timely and actionable insights that inform operational and strategic decision-making
Maintain data dictionaries and documentation for all recurring reports and dashboards
Support innovation in data tools and analytic methodologies, including emerging technologies, to advance the program’s data infrastructure
